The Impact of Green Human Resource Management (GHRM) In Achieving Outstanding Performance/ A survey study of the opinions of a sample of members of the Northern Technical University formations in Mosul

The research seeks to show the impact of green human resources management in achieving outstanding performance. As the current trend towards a green or sustainable environment in all areas of business, including the management of green human resources, Which determines the importance of the human resource and the work it performs in order to achieve outstanding performance in the field of work including what appeared in green universities, A group of formations of the Northern Technical University in Mosul were selected as an applied research field to verify the main research hypotheses,Which shows that there is a correlation and is collected through the statistical program SPSS. v.25, To study the impact of green human resources management on the outstanding performance of the research organization through the electronic questionnaire form.Therefore, the research concluded to present a set of conclusions that confirm the existence of a positive and highly significant moral correlation and impact between green human resource management and outstanding performance.This indicates that the research organization pays attention to green human resources and in a way that led us to present some proposals, including the need to work on strengthening the strengths of the organization and developing employees with green behaviors by conducting several courses on green human resources management to achieve outstanding performance in them.
